←  Szukam pluginu

AMXX.pl: Support AMX Mod X i SourceMod

»

[ROZWIĄZANE] Zmiana modeli gracza.


Best Answer wiwi249 17.09.2014 18:59

Łap mój stary kod, który robiłem koledze, skonfiguruj pod siebie.

new const CT_Models[2][] = {
	"modelct",
	"modelct_vip"
}

new const TT_Models[2][] = {
	"modeltt",
	"modeltt_vip"
}

Powinno działać jak trzeba, jak coś będzie nie tego, to znaczy, że to nie wina pluginu tylko czegoś innego.

Do starszyzny, wiem, że nie musiałem tego robić switchem ale robiłem to na szybko i jakos średnio sie zastanawiałem nad formułami. Może zaraz wrzucę poprawiony.

 

I proszę sie nie śmiać, że w AMXX Studio robiony bo używam i bardzo lubię :D

 

PS. Z autopsji radzę Ci pobrać .sma i skompilować lokalnie, a nie pobierać z załącznika AMXX skompilowane przez nasz kompilator.

Go to the full post
Locked

  • +
  • -
Dziobak?'s Photo Dziobak? 17.09.2014

Poszukuję pluginy który podmienia graczą wygląd który nie wywala błędów, bo np obecnie posiadam coś takiego

/* Plugin generated by AMXX-Studio */


#include <amxmodx>
#include <cstrike>
#include <hamsandwich>



public plugin_init()
{
	register_plugin("Zmiana modeli gracza", "1.0", "Play");
	RegisterHam(Ham_Spawn, "player", "Odrodzenie", 1);
}



public plugin_precache()
{
	precache_model("models/player/MwTT/MwTT.mdl")
	precache_model("models/player/MwCT/MwCT.mdl")
}

public Odrodzenie(id)
{
	if(get_user_team(id) == 1)
	{
		cs_set_user_model(id, "MwTT");

	}
	
	else if(get_user_team(id) == 2)

	{

        cs_set_user_model(id, "MwCT");
    }

}

 

i wyrzuca graczy z serwera z błędem

Reliable channel overflow
Quote

  • +
  • -
Rellik #'s Photo Rellik # 17.09.2014

Jeśli się nie mylę to ten błąd:

Reliable channel overflow

wywala ponieważ twój serwer wysyła za dużo informacji/wiadomości do gracza (hud, say, pliki) . 

 

Swoją drogą ...Jesteś pewien , że ten plugin jest temu winien?

 

@edit.

 

Również PreThink'i zabierają dużo CPU oraz mogą powodować ten błąd. Więc polecam ograniczenie pluginów z PreThinkami .


Edited by sKato., 17.09.2014 19:02.
Quote

  • +
  • -
Best Answer wiwi249's Photo wiwi249 17.09.2014

Łap mój stary kod, który robiłem koledze, skonfiguruj pod siebie.

new const CT_Models[2][] = {
	"modelct",
	"modelct_vip"
}

new const TT_Models[2][] = {
	"modeltt",
	"modeltt_vip"
}

Powinno działać jak trzeba, jak coś będzie nie tego, to znaczy, że to nie wina pluginu tylko czegoś innego.

Do starszyzny, wiem, że nie musiałem tego robić switchem ale robiłem to na szybko i jakos średnio sie zastanawiałem nad formułami. Może zaraz wrzucę poprawiony.

 

I proszę sie nie śmiać, że w AMXX Studio robiony bo używam i bardzo lubię :D

 

PS. Z autopsji radzę Ci pobrać .sma i skompilować lokalnie, a nie pobierać z załącznika AMXX skompilowane przez nasz kompilator.

Attached Files


Edited by wiwi249, 17.09.2014 19:02.
Quote

  • +
  • -
wiwi249's Photo wiwi249 17.09.2014

W załączniku powinna być poprawiona, lepsza wersja, konfigurujesz tylko w tablicach, które wskazalem w pierwszym poście.

Dodatkowo przewidziane są modele dla VIPa, jak nie potrzebujesz to wywal.

 

Vip, jak widać, jest na flagę ADMIN_LEVEL_A. Jakby coś nie chodzilo to pisz.

Attached Files

Quote

  • +
  • -
Dziobak?'s Photo Dziobak? 17.09.2014

To jest wina znacznie tego pluginu jaki podałem, bo jak go wyłączyłem to nikogo już nie kicka :)

 

Łap mój stary kod, który robiłem koledze, skonfiguruj pod siebie.

new const CT_Models[2][] = {
	"modelct",
	"modelct_vip"
}

new const TT_Models[2][] = {
	"modeltt",
	"modeltt_vip"
}

Powinno działać jak trzeba, jak coś będzie nie tego, to znaczy, że to nie wina pluginu tylko czegoś innego.

Do starszyzny, wiem, że nie musiałem tego robić switchem ale robiłem to na szybko i jakos średnio sie zastanawiałem nad formułami. Może zaraz wrzucę poprawiony.

 

I proszę sie nie śmiać, że w AMXX Studio robiony bo używam i bardzo lubię :D

 

PS. Z autopsji radzę Ci pobrać .sma i skompilować lokalnie, a nie pobierać z załącznika AMXX skompilowane przez nasz kompilator.

 

ja też korzystam z AMXX-Studio, ponieważ mi najlepiej odpowiada, dzięki ci sprawdzę plugin :)

Quote
Locked